Before Viva Films, Star Cinema, and Regal Entertainment Inc, there was Sampaguita Pictures, Premiere Productions, LVN Pictures, and Lebran Pictures.

GOLDEN ERA. Philippine Cinema will not be complete with the contributions of its film companies known as the Big 4. Photos by Dion Besa/Rappler

MANILA, Philippines – Before the likes of Viva Films, Regal Films, and Star Cinema dominated the Philippines box office, there existed the movie companies that started it all.LVN was founded in 1938 by Narcisa de Leon, Carmen Villongco, and Eleuterio Navoa Jr. The initials"LVN" were taken from the founders’ family names. Narcisa or Doña Sisang was the company's executive producer.
